For over 60 years, the Public Affairs Forum has been bringing together community leaders, members, and guests who care about what happens in Washington County, the Metro region, and our state.



ABOUT US

We provide a neutral platform for the open exchange of ideas on important civic matters, stimulating thinking and promoting informed public policy discussions.

Our History

Founded in 1956, we have a long-standing tradition of fostering community engagement and civic participation.

Our Values

We are committed to providing a welcoming and inclusive space for all voices to be heard.

The Washington County Public Affairs Monthly Forum is where community leaders and residents connect to discuss public policy issues impacting our county and beyond. We foster open dialogue and diverse perspectives in a neutral setting.

While we present a variety of viewpoints, the opinions expressed by our speakers are their own and do not necessarily reflect the views of the Forum.


WHEN

2nd Monday of each month (September - June)

12pm-1pm

LOCATION

The Old Spaghetti Factory
10425 NE Tanasbourne Dr,
Hillsboro, OR 97124
